Dividing layers for Boston Cream Pie

Posted: Nov 22, 2008 4:22 AM
Many years ago my Grandmother taught me an easy way to divide a cake for Boston Cream Pie is to take a long piece of sewing thread and slide it through the cake. It works easily and turns out great !
